geckoWebBrowser 填充数据
时间: 2024-04-21 18:25:29 浏览: 63
Laravel框架使用Seeder实现自动填充数据功能
如果你想在 Gecko Web Browser 中填充数据,你可以使用 GeckoFX。GeckoFX 是一个.NET 控件库,它可以在 Windows Forms 应用程序中嵌入 Gecko Web Browser。你可以使用 GeckoFX 在代码中填充数据。
首先,你需要添加对 GeckoFX 的引用。可以在 Visual Studio 中通过 NuGet 下载并安装 GeckoFX。
然后,你可以使用以下代码将数据填充到文本框中:
```csharp
GeckoWebBrowser browser = new GeckoWebBrowser();
browser.Navigate("https://www.example.com");
browser.DocumentCompleted += (sender, args) =>
{
GeckoInputElement inputElement = browser.Document.GetElementById("input-id") as GeckoInputElement;
if (inputElement != null)
{
inputElement.Value = "填充的数据";
}
};
```
在这个例子中,我们首先创建了一个 GeckoWebBrowser 实例,并导航到一个网站。然后,我们在 DocumentCompleted 事件中查找一个 ID 为 "input-id" 的元素,并将其值设置为 "填充的数据"。
当然,这只是一个简单的示例,你可以根据你的具体需求来使用 GeckoFX 填充更多类型的数据。
阅读全文